As we transition out of summer and into autumn, I thought I'd re-surface this episode from 2 autumns back, when I discovered the simple pleasure of playing music in the shower. Thanks to the cutting edge technology of waterproof bluetooth speakers, a whole new world of environmental sound opens up. Experience this new world in style, and bask in sounds that roll of your skin like so much rushing water. TRACKLIST Robert Aiki Aubrey Lowe & Ariel Kalma - Miracle Mile [RVNG] 日向敏文 - Chaconne [Light In the Attic] Lapalux - Opilio [Brainfeeder] Heaven - Blood On The Tracks [Italians Do It Better] Cherushii - Ultraviolet Nights [100% Silk] Roza Terenzi & DJ Zozi - Strobe Foundation [Planet Euphorique] RAMZi - warhasu ft. Hashman Deejay [FATi] Yak - Don Greno [3024] Urulu - Precinct 9 (Ex-Terrestrial's Extremix) [Kalahari Oyster Cult] Peach - Faxing Jupiter [DJ-Kicks] Baltra - Can't Explain It [Of Paradise] Gerd - Black Moon Voyage [Royal Oak] Sapphire Slows - Sometimes [100% Silk] Ttam Renat - Mergin (Hut Mix) [Mood Hut] Yoshiaki Ochi - Ear Dreamin' [Light In The Attic]
